The Base

 

The_BaseAffectionately called 'The Sandbag Bunker' due to the amount of sandbags that were needed to be filled to construct the base and line all of the fox holes surrounding the base. It is located on top of a hill in the middle of the wide open field. The base itself is approximately 8' x 12' feet and stands over eight feet tall. The outside of the base is surrounded with a single layer of sandbags (after all this is airsoft). Surrounding the base are several fox holes approximately four to five feet deep and the tops are lined with sandbags.

During Operation: Insertion the base represented LZ-X ray and was the primary location for the American's during the ten hour struggle. For Operation: Clean Sweep the base was named 'Fire Base Charlie' and was the staging area for the American's during the entire op. It was during this op that the Vietcong over ran 'Fire Base Charlie' and drove the American's from the area. When it came time for Operation: Iron Triangle it was the first rotation objective to regain control of this important strategic asset.

Black Ops Airsoft is constantly attempting to improve the playing field. Future plans for this area are to create tower that will over look the entire field. Also the number of foxholes will be increased and they will be improved for a better defensive position. Also there are plans for another base the same size to be built on the same hill top.

Underground Bunker

Underground_BunkerDirectly across the field from the Sandbag Bunker is a second base known as 'The Dugout Bunker". It is approximately the same size as the Sandbag Bunker but this is buried five feet underground and the top edges are lined with sandbags. A deep trench runs out of the bunker and into the open field giving the occupants a direct path of travel. Also there is a back entrance to the bunker. This base is located on top of a hill (a though a bit smaller) just like the other bunker.

During Operation: Insertion this was the main base for the Vietcong. At the end of the day the American's assaulted this position and the Vietcong were allowed to defend it. It made for an intense fire fight. Since that time this base has seen plenty of skirmishes and smaller fire fights. It is because of these past experiences BOA has learned several ways to improve this location and improve upon its defense.

Future plans for this site include covering the trench giving it a more underground feel as well as creating another dugout section the same size as the original. Eventually there will be trenches and covered tunnels leading from one position to another. Also there will be a look out tower built between the two bunkers similar to the one that will be built at the Sandbag Bunker.

News and Updates

September 2011

Black Ops Airsoft hosted Operation: Deliberate Force 2. The event was organized and operated by Brian Dana. This was Brian's second operation that he had organized this year at Black Ops Airsoft. There were over seventy players on the field during the operation. Thank you to all the players who traveled to the field in Penn Yan, New York to attend Operation: Deliberate Force 2. Thank you to Brian for organizing another outstanding operation.

August 2011

Black Ops Airsoft hosted skirmishes ever weekend in the month of August. The average attendance for the skirmishes was 35 players. BOA has seen a large number of new players and the return of all of our veteran players.

July 2011

Performance Hobbies from Webster New York, hosted Operation: Signho-Ri at the field in Penn Yan, New York. The operation was organized and operated by employees of Performance Hobbies, a long time sponsor of Black Ops Airsoft. Over fifty players attended this operation. Thank you to all the players who attended this operation.

June 2011

Black Ops Airsoft hosted Operation: Red Clover. The event was organized and operated by Brian Dana, a long time member of Black Ops Airsoft. The game was a huge success by all of the players and the Black Ops Airsoft Owners. Thank you to all the players that attended this operation and a special thankful to Brian Dana for running a great operation.

May 2011

Black Ops Airsoft is proud to announce the second annual K-9 Trainer Seminar held by the Yates County Sheriffs Department. Sheriffs from all across the east coast traveled to Penn Yan to attend the seminar. The sheriffs and their K9 partners visited BOA for an entire day praticing, running scenarios in the village, tracking through the woods and other training programs.

Mike Haggerty from Frontier Airsoft hosted Bitter Harvest 3 at Black Ops Airsoft. Over 100 players attended this event. Players came from Buffalo, Rochester, Syracuse, and Albany to attend this event.
